U.S., Feb. 12 -- ClinicalTrials.gov registry received information related to the study (NCT06819189) titled 'Role of Metal Ion Transporter ZIP8 in Alcohol-Related Behaviors' on Feb. 08.
Brief Summary: Background:
Alcohol use disorder (AUD) can damage people s health, work, and family. Researchers want to know more about why some people are more vulnerable to AUD than others. The ZIP8 gene may be linked to an increased risk of AUD. Researchers want to find out how different forms of the ZIP8 gene affect how healthy people drink alcohol and how alcohol affects their brain.
Objective:
To study how genes may affect how people drink alcohol and how it affects their brain.
